THERMOSTAT REMOVAL/INSTALLATIONA6E361815171201MZR-CD (RF Turbo)
1. Disconnect the negative battery cable.
2. Remove the under cover.
3. Drain the engine coolant.
4. Remove in the order indicated in the table.
5. Install in the reverse order of removal.
6. Fill the radiator with the specified amount and type of engine coolant.
7. Inspect the engine coolant leakage. (See E–8 ENGINE COOLANT LEAKAGE INSPECTION.)
Thermostat Installation Note
1. Verify that the positions of the jiggle pin and the projection on the gasket are as shown.
2. Install the thermostat into the thermostat case, aligning the projection on the gasket to the thermostat cover.
End Of Sie

TRANSAXLE OIL INSPECTIONA6E5212270012011. Park the vehicle on level ground.
2. Remove the filler plug and gasket.
3. Verify that the oil is near the brim of the plug port.
•If the oil level is low, add the specified amount
and type of oil through the filler plug hole.
Specified oil grade
API Service GL-4 or GL-5
Specified oil viscosity
SAE 75W-90
4. Install a new gasket and the filler plug.
Tightening torque
30.0—39.0 N·m
{3.06—3.98 kgf·m, 22.1—28.8 in·lbf}
End Of Sie
TRANSAXLE OIL REPLACEMENTA6E5212270012021. Remove the drain plug with the gasket.
2. Drain the oil into a suitable container.
3. Install a new gasket and the drain plug.
Tightening torque
30.0—39.0 N·m
{3.06—3.98 kgf·m, 22.1—28.8 in·lbf}
4. Remove the filler plug with gasket and add the
specified amount and type of oil through the filler
plug hole until the level reaches the bottom of the
filler plug hole.
Specified oil grade
API Service GL-4 or GL-5
Specified oil viscosity
SAE 75W-90
Capacity (approximate quantity)
2.30 L {2.40 US qt, 2.00 lmp qt}
5. Install a new gasket and the filler plug.
Tightening torque
30.0—39.0 N·m
{3.06—3.98 kgf·m, 22.1—28.8 in·lbf}
End Of Sie
